Role: Residential Childcare Worker (RCW) / Residential Support Worker (RSW) – Children’s Homes Location: Preston and Surrounding Areas (Bamber Bridge Walton-le-Dale Lostock Hall Leyland Clayton-le-Woods Chorley) Salary: Up to £35,500 per annum Hours: 39.2 hours per week. Shift pattern: 5 week rolling rota - 2 days on, 3 days off Shift Times: 8am - 10pm followed by a sleep in Sleep Ins: Approximately 12 sleep ins per month £55 paid per sleep-in carried out. Northridge Care Group is recruiting for Residential Childcare Workers / Residential Support Workers to join our children’s residential homes. Our services support young people with emotional and behavioural difficulties (EBD), learning disabilities (LD), autism, and other complex needs. This is an opportunity to work within a children’s residential care setting, providing consistent, high-quality support and contributing to positive outcomes for young people. The Role We are looking for a dedicated and compassionate Key Worker to support children and young people in their daily lives. In this role, you will play an important part in helping them feel safe, valued, and supported while developing the skills they need for the future. You will provide consistent, warm, and empowering care, ensuring every young person’s individual needs, voice, and rights are respected. Key responsibilities include:
Provide high-quality care within a children’s residential home (EBD and LD services)Support young people with emotional and behavioural needs, learning disabilities, and autismAct as a key worker, contributing to care plans and placement plansSupport daily routines, education, and the development of life skills and independenceDeliver trauma-informed and person-centred carePromote positive behaviour and support young people to achieve positive outcomesSafeguard and advocate for young people, following safeguarding proceduresMaintain accurate daily records, incident reports, and documentationContribute to maintaining Ofsted standards and a safe residential environment This is a rewarding opportunity to make a meaningful difference in the lives of young people and help them build brighter futures. What we’re looking for: We are particularly keen to hear from candidates who are qualified in Residential Childcare (or hold an equivalent qualification), or who can demonstrate strong relevant experience in children’s residential settings. Training Requirement All successful candidates will be required to commit to a 2-week onsite training and induction programme before starting shifts. This ensures you are fully prepared to deliver safe, high-quality care in line with our standards. Northridge Group implements safeguarding protocols in all aspects of their working practices and is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people. All successful applicants will be required to undertake an enhanced
DBS check and this may include social media checks.
